Training course for Island residents
Recognising and tackling abuse is the focus of a training programme this week (28th-29th Sept).
Speakers from the Emerge scheme, which has been running in the USA since 1977, are visiting the Island to educate charities, service professionals and the general public on the subject.
Organisers say abuse can take many forms, and is an issue which society as a whole should face up to.
